The cheapest way to get from London to Marlborough is to drive which costs £18 - £27 and takes 1h 32m.
The fastest way to get from London to Marlborough is to drive which takes 1h 32m and costs £18 - £27.
No, there is no direct bus from London to Marlborough. However, there are services departing from London Victoria and arriving at Lloyds Bank via Fleming Way.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 37m.
The distance between London and Marlborough is 91 miles. The road distance is 77.4 miles.
The best way to get from London to Marlborough without a car is to train and bus which takes 2h 10m and costs .
It takes approximately 2h 10m to get from London to Marlborough, including transfers.
London to Marlborough bus services, operated by National Express, depart from London Victoria station.
London to Marlborough bus services, operated by National Express, arrive at Fleming Way station.
Yes, the driving distance between London to Marlborough is 77 miles. It takes approximately 1h 32m to drive from London to Marlborough.
